My choices for top five in no particular order.

723 Bobier 99
940 Mombert 98
871 Richart 97
865 Mettler 98
862.5* Hester 99

I base this on what they have produced so far and just
as important I have them in my inventory of seeds.  
The Calai, Lloyd, and Stelts seeds have all done well, 
but I don't have them.  And even though I consider these seeds
to have great potential, I will probably be planting the 835 McIntyre
again next year instead of some of these simply because
I think I can do better with it than I did this year and it produced
my best looking AG yet.  I'd like to grow one just as pretty and
twice the size of what I grew this year.
